This weekend looks to be a real summertime scorcher, with temps possibly hitting as high as 100 degrees on Sunday. With that in mind there are many great free events happening outside to take your mind off the heat. In this edition of Freeloader Friday there are not one, but two 24-hour festivals. One is the Northern Spark, featuring art installations, performances, parties, and more around town. The other is BioBlitz, a science fest where professors and volunteers attempt to count as many species as possible in a specific area.

Other activities on our list include the Lyndale Open Street Fest, a '90s dance party, and a bike messenger movie starring Kevin Bacon. Come take a look.

BioBlitz
(Cedar Creek Ecosystem Science Reserve, 2660 Fawn Lake Dr NE, East Bethel, 763-434-5131, www.cedarcreek.umn.edu)

At this 24-hour survey the public helps scientists find and classify all of the plants and animals they can at a specific location. Click here to signup. 5 p.m. Fri. to 5 p.m. Sat.
